Frequently Asked Questions
What can I encode in a QR code?
You can encode URLs, plain text, contact information, Wi-Fi credentials, calendar events, and more. The most common use is sharing a website link.
Is there a size limit?
QR codes can store up to 2953 bytes of data. For best results, keep URLs under 200 characters.
Is the generated QR code permanent?
The QR code encodes whatever text you enter. As long as you download the PNG image, it will work indefinitely. The tool does not store any data on a server.
